Description
Bucrylate (CAS 1069-55-2) is a specialized cyanoacrylate ester with the molecular formula C8H11NO2 and the IUPAC name 2-methylpropyl 2-cyanoprop-2-enoate. This high-purity adhesive monomer is designed for research and industrial applications requiring rapid polymerization upon exposure to moisture. Bucrylate exhibits excellent bonding strength for substrates such as metals, plastics, and biological tissues, with enhanced flexibility compared to traditional cyanoacrylates due to its isobutyl ester group. The product is supplied as a clear, low-viscosity liquid stabilized with radical inhibitors for extended shelf life. Suitable for controlled laboratory use, it is packaged under inert gas in amber glass vials to prevent premature curing. Researchers should handle this material in a well-ventilated environment using appropriate PPE due to its reactive nature and potential sensitization properties.

Application
Bucrylate is primarily employed as a fast-setting surgical adhesive for experimental wound closure and tissue approximation in biomedical research. Its medical-grade formulation allows for investigation of hemostatic properties in vascular and dermatological applications. The compound also serves as a model cyanoacrylate for studying polymerization kinetics and adhesive performance on atypical substrates. Industrial researchers utilize bucrylate for developing specialized adhesives in electronics assembly and microdevice fabrication.
Safety and Hazards
GHS Hazard Statements
- H315 (100%): Causes skin irritation [Warning Skin corrosion/irritation]
- H319 (100%): Causes serious eye irritation [Warning Serious eye damage/eye irritation]
- H335 (100%): May cause respiratory irritation [Warning Specific target organ toxicity, single exposure; Respiratory tract irritation]
